Chimney in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a chimney’s interior and exterior components to identify potential issues. Professionals typically examine the flue, chimney lining, masonry, and surrounding areas to detect signs of damage, creosote buildup, blockages, or structural weaknesses. These inspections often utilize specialized tools such as cameras to provide a detailed view of the chimney’s condition, helping to ensure it functions safely and efficiently. Regular inspections can help prevent problems before they develop into more costly repairs or safety hazards.
One of the primary benefits of chimney inspection services is identifying issues that could lead to fire hazards or harmful indoor air quality. Creosote buildup, cracks in the chimney lining, or obstructions such as nests or debris can increase the risk of chimney fires or carbon monoxide leaks. By pinpointing these problems early, homeowners and property managers can take appropriate action to address them, reducing the likelihood of dangerous situations. Inspections also help verify that a chimney is compliant with safety standards and functioning as intended, especially before the start of the heating season.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a chimney inspection 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the chimney. For example, a basic visual inspection in Oxford, OH, might be around $120. More detailed inspections can reach higher prices based on the scope.
Service Fees - Service fees for chimney inspection services generally fall between $75 and $200. This fee covers the assessment and identification of potential issues, with costs varying by location and service provider in the Oxford area.
Additional Charges - Additional charges may apply for chimney cleaning, repairs, or extensive evaluations, often adding $50 to $150 to the initial inspection cost. These costs depend on the condition of the chimney and the extent of the work needed.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include chimney height, accessibility, and the inspection type (visual or detailed). Prices can vary significantly, with some services charging more for complex or hard-to-reach chimneys in the Oxford, OH region.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in a chimney inspection service? A chimney inspection typically includes examining the interior and exterior of the chimney for damage, blockages, or creosote buildup, and assessing the overall condition of the chimney structure.
How often should a chimney be inspected? It is recommended to have a chimney inspected at least once a year, especially before the heating season begins or after any significant weather events.
What are signs that a chimney needs inspection or repair? Signs include smoke backing into the home, a strong odor, visible creosote buildup, cracks or deterioration in the chimney structure, or if it has not been inspected in over a year.
What types of professionals provide chimney inspection services? Chimney inspection services are offered by specialized chimney contractors, masonry specialists, or home inspection professionals experienced with chimneys.
